引言 在数字时代的浪潮中,数字货币逐渐崭露头角,塑造了全新的金融生态。而作为与数字货币直接相关的重要工具...
区块链技术的发展使得数字货币的使用越来越普遍,而区块链作为存储和管理这些数字资产的工具,显得尤为重要。无论是对普通用户,还是对开发者而言,理解区块链的搭建方法与步骤是至关重要的。一个安全、稳定的区块链可以有效地保护用户的资产,同时也为用户提供了便捷的交易体验。本文将详细介绍区块链的搭建方法与步骤,并对相关问题进行深入探讨。
区块链是一个用来存储和管理数字资产(如比特币、以太坊等)的数字工具。与传统的银行账户不同,区块链不依赖于中介机构,而是通过分布式的区块链技术确保用户的资产安全。的主要功能包括发起交易、接收资产和查看余额等。
搭建一个区块链大致可以分为以下几个步骤:
首先,你需要根据自己的需求选择适合的类型。区块链通常分为以下几种类型:
在选择类型时,可以考虑你的使用场景及安全需求。
根据你想要支持的数字货币,选择相应的区块链平台。例如,比特币需要使用比特币的区块链,而以太坊则需要使用以太坊的区块链。
每个区块链平台都有其独特之处,因此需要对其生态系统和技术特性进行深入了解,以确保所选平台能够满足自己的需求。
搭建之前,需要设置开发环境。你可以选择使用本地环境(如Node.js、Python等)来构建,也可以使用现成的SDK进行开发。确保你已经安装必要的库和依赖项,以支持区块链的功能。
每个区块链都有其独特的密钥对,包含公钥和私钥。公钥可以共享给其他人以接收资产,而私钥则需妥善保管,因为它直接影响内资产的安全性。通常可以使用加密算法生成密钥对,比如椭圆曲线算法(ECDSA)。
完成密钥的生成后,可以开始开发和部署应用。实现功能时,可能包括资产转账、余额查询、交易记录获取等。将应用部署到支持区块链的网络上,确保其能够正常与区块链交互。
在正式使用前,必须进行全面的测试,包括功能测试、安全性测试和性能测试等。可以使用测试网络(如比特币的Testnet)进行测试,确保所有功能正常且安全性达到标准。
经过充分的测试后,可以将发布给用户。上线后,需要定期对进行更新和维护,以修复可能出现的问题和漏洞,确保用户资金的安全。
在数字货币的管理中,冷和热各自有其特定的优势和适用场景。热适合频繁交易,因为它使用户可以快速访问和处理资产。而冷则适合长期持有,因为它提供了更高的安全性,不连接互联网,能够有效防止黑客攻击和盗窃。因此,用户通常会选择同时使用两种,热用于日常交易,冷用于长期存储。合理搭配使用,可以提高用户的资产管理效率和安全性。
确保区块链安全的关键在于密钥管理。用户应使用强密码来保护,并启用双重身份验证等额外的安全措施。此外,要定期更新软件,修复可能的安全漏洞。同时,用户还应备份私钥,将其存储在安全地点,以防丢失。避免在公共网络下访问,确保使用安全的设备。通过实施这些措施,能够最大程度地降低资产被盗或丢失的风险。
区块链的交易费用主要与区块链网络的拥堵情况有关。在网络拥堵时,交易费用通常会提高,用户可以选择支付更高的费用以加快交易确认的速度。不同区块链平台的费用结构也有所不同,用户在发起交易时,可以根据自身需求选择相应的费用。此外,有些会提供费用估算和的功能,用户可以根据这些建议合理选择交易费用。掌握这些信息,可以帮助用户在交易时更有效地节省成本。
恢复通常需要备份种子短语(mnemonic phrase)或私钥。如果用户丢失了访问的途径,可以通过恢复这些信息来找回资产。用户应确保这些关键信息安全存储,并考虑使用多种备份方式,例如打印或手动保存到安全的地方。在设置时,提供并保存种子短语的明确指导是用户体验的重要部分,使用者应养成妥善管理备份的习惯,以免将来面临无法恢复资产的困境。
随着区块链技术的不断进步,的发展也在不断演变。未来区块链可能会更加注重用户体验和安全性。例如,智能合约的集成使得可以自动执行某些交易,提供更高效的处理能力。此外,多种加密资产的支持、链上身份验证的集成,以及与其他金融服务的联动,也将成为未来发展的重要趋势。同时,用户教育也将成为一个关键领域,帮助用户更好地了解如何安全地使用和管理他们的数字资产。
搭建区块链不仅需要对技术有深入的理解,还需要在设计与安全性上多加考量。通过选择合适的类型、平台及工具,并遵循正确的搭建步骤,用户或开发者可以创建出一个功能齐全、操作便捷且安全性高的区块链。随着区块链技术的不断发展,的未来将会更加智能与便利,期待未来在数字资产管理中的广泛应用和影响。